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
359788927 00750015703 0990974897 09738240506 65477
2521898539 034468372
2521898539 034468372
97 4596 2311058
All about undefined
Interested in learning more?
2521898539 034468372
97 4596 2311058
See more
96915595 21841614523
74443506952 328861 44968
See more
7267 948092 9376705
49285363514 435895 951838 09
See more